๋๋ ์ด๋ค ๊ณผ๋ชฉ์ ๋ํด ๊ณต๋ถ๋ฅผ ํ ๋ ๋ ์ธ์๋ ์ฑ ์ ๊ตฌ๋งคํด์ ๋ณด๋ ํธ์ด๋ค.
๋์ค์ ๋ญ๊ฐ ํน์ ๋ด์ฉ์ ๋ํด ์ฐพ์ผ๋ ค๊ณ ์ฑ ์ ๋ ๋ค๋ฌ๋ณด๋ค๋ณด๋ฉด Ctrl + F ๊ฐ ๊ทธ๋ฆฌ์ด ๊ฒฝ์ฐ๋ ๋ง์ง๋ง (...)
๋ด๊ฐ ์ถ๊ฐ์ ์ผ๋ก ์๊ฒ ๋ ๋ด์ฉ์๋ ๋ฉ๋ชจ๋ ํ๊ณ ์ค์ํ๋ค ์ถ์ ๊ตฌ์ ์ ๋ฐ์ค๋ ๊ทธ์ด๊ฐ๋ฉฐ ๋ณผ ์ ์๋
์ธ์์ฑ ๋ง์ ๋งค๋ ฅ์ด ์๋ ๊ฒ ๊ฐ๋ค.
์๋๋ฉด ๊ทธ๋ฅ ๋์ด๋จน์์ฌ๋ ํน์ง์ผ์๋ ...
๊ตญ๋นํ์์ถ์ ๋น์ ๊ณต์๋ก
ํ์์์๋ ์๋ฐ ํ๋ ์์ํฌ ์คํ๋ง๋ถํธ3์ ์ด์ฉํด ์ฝ 5๊ฐ์ ์๋๋ ๊ธฐ๊ฐ๋์ ํ๋ก์ ํธ๋ฅผ ์งํํ์๋ค.
์ ๋ง ์งง์ ๊ธฐ๊ฐ์์ ์คํ๋ง๋ถํธ๋ฅผ ๋ฐฐ์ฐ๊ณ ์ฌ์ฉํ ๋ฏ..
๊ต์ก์ด ๋๋๊ณ ๋ณธ๊ฒฉ์ ์ผ๋ก ์ทจ์ ํ๋์ ๋ค์ด๊ฐ๋ฉด์ ๊ฐ๋ฐ์ ์ทจ์ ๊ณต๊ณ ๋ฅผ ์ฃผ์ฑ ๋ณด๋
JAVA ๊ฐ๋ฐ์๋ฅผ ๊ตฌ์ธํ๋ ํ์ฌ๋ ๋ณดํต ์๊ฒฉ์๊ฑด์ผ๋ก spring boot ๋ฅผ ํจ๊ป ์๊ตฌํ๊ณ ์์๋ค.
(์ด์ ๋๋ฉด mybatis, springboot ๋ ์น ๋ฐฑ์๋ ๊ฐ๋ฐ์ ์ง๋ง์ ๊ธฐ๋ณธ ์์์ธ ๊ฒ ๊ฐ๋ค)
๊ทธ๋์ ๋น์ค๋น์คํ ๋์ spring boot ๋ด๊ณต์ ํํํ๊ฒ ๋จ๋ จ์์ผ์ค ๊ต์ฌ๋ฅผ ์ฐพ๋ค๊ฐ
์ด์ง์คํผ๋ธ๋ฆฌ์ฑ ์ถํ์ฌ์ << Do it! ์ ํ ํฌ ์คํ๋ง๋ถํธ3 >> ์ ๋ง๋๊ฒ ๋๋ค!
๋๋ Do it ์๋ฆฌ์ฆ ๊ต์ฌ๋ค ์ค
<< HTML+CSS ์๋ฐ์คํฌ๋ฆฝํธ ์น ํ์ค ์ ์>> , <<์น ์ฌ์ดํธ ๋ฐ๋ผ ๋ง๋ค๊ธฐ>> ๋ ๊ฐ์ง๊ณ ์๋ค.
์ด์ง์คํผ๋ธ๋ฆฌ์ฑ ์ถํ์ฌ์ Do it ์๋ฆฌ์ฆ ์ฑ ๋ค์
๋ฌธ๋ฒ๋ ๋ฌธ๋ฒ์ด์ง๋ง ๋ฐ๋ผ ๋ง๋ค์ด๋ณผ ์ ์๋ ์์ฉ ๋ด์ฉ์ด ๋ง์ ์ข์ ๊ฒ ๊ฐ๋ค.
<< Do it! ์ ํ ํฌ ์คํ๋ง ๋ถํธ3 >> ๊ต์ฌ๋
๊ฒ์ํ, ํ์๊ฐ์ , ๋ก๊ทธ์ธ, ์ถ์ฒ ๊ธฐ๋ฅ, ๊ฒ์ ๊ธฐ๋ฅ ๋ฑ
์ค์ ๋ก ์น ์ฌ์ดํธ ๊ฐ๋ฐ ํ ๋ ์ ๋ง ๋ง์ด ๋ง๋ค๊ฒ ๋ ๊ธฐ๋ฅ์ ๋ฐ๋ผ ๋ง๋ค์ด๋ณด๊ฒ ๋์ด ์์ด
์ค๋ฌด ํ์ฉ๋๊ฐ ๋งค์ฐ ๋์ ๋ง์กฑ ๋ง์กฑ ๋๋ง์กฑ!
์ญ์ ํ์ง ๊ฐ๋ฐ์๊ฐ ๋ง๋ ์ฑ ์ ๋ค๋ฅด๋ค ์ถ์๋ค. ๐
์ข์ ์ 1. ์์ฐฌ ๋ชฉ์ฐจ ๊ตฌ์ฑ
์ฑ ์ ๊ฐ์ฅ ์ต์ ๋ฒ์ spring boot 3 ๊ธฐ์ค์ผ๋ก ์์ฑ๋์ด ์๋ค.
์คํ๋ง ๋ถํธ ๊ฐ์์ JDK ์ค์น๋ถํฐ ํ๋ก์ ํธ ์์ฑ ๊ทธ๋ฆฌ๊ณ STS(spring tool suite) IDE ํด์ ์ฌ์ฉ ๋ฐฉ๋ฒ
์ค์ ํํ๋ก์ ํธ์์๋ ์ ๋ง ๋ง์ ๋์์ ๋ฐ์๋ lombok, thymeleaf ๋ผ์ด๋ธ๋ฌ๋ฆฌ ์ฌ์ฉ ๋ฑ๋ฑ
์ง์ง ์ค์ํ ๋ด์ฉ๋ค๋ก ์์ฐจ๊ฒ ๊ตฌ์ฑ๋์ด ์์ด์
๋ด๊ฐ ์คํ๋ง๋ถํธ๋ฅผ ํ์ฐธ ๋ฐฐ์ธ ๋ ์ด ์ฑ ์ด ์์๋๋ผ๋ฉด ์ผ๋ง๋ ์ข์์๊น ํ๋ ์๊ฐ์ ํ๋ค...๐ฅ
์ข์ ์ 2. ๋ ํ๋ฌ๋ฅผ ์ํ ๋ฐฐ๋ ค๊ฐ ๋๋ณด์ด๋ ์ฑ
์ฑ ์ ์ ๋ถ๋ถ์๋ ์ด๋ณด์์ผ ๋ ์ด ์ฑ ์ ๊ฐ์ง๊ณ ๊ณต๋ถํ๋ ๋ฐฉ๋ฒ ๋ฐ ์ค์ผ์ค๋ฌ๊ฐ ์ ์ ๋ฆฌ๋์ด ์๋ค.
๊ทธ๋ฆฌ๊ณ ์คํ๋ง ๋ถํธ๋ก ์์ ํ ๋
์คํ๋ง๋ถํธ ๋ฟ ์๋๋ผ ๋ฐ์ดํฐ๋ฒ ์ด์ค์ html css๋ ํจ๊ป ์์ ํ ์ ๋ฐ์ ์๊ธฐ ๋๋ฌธ์
์ค๊ฐ์ค๊ฐ ๋ฐ์ดํฐ๋ฒ ์ด์ค์ ํ๋ฉด์ ๋ํ ๊ฐ๋จํ ์๋ด ์ฑํฐ๋ ์์ด ์ธ์ธํ ๋ฐฐ๋ ค๊ฐ ๋๋ณด์๋ค.
๋ฌผ๋ก ์ด ์ฑ ์ ์คํ๋ง ๋ถํธ3 ๊ต์ฌ์ด๊ธฐ ๋๋ฌธ์ ์์ฒญ ์์ธํ๊ฒ ์ ํ์ ธ ์์ง ์๋ค.
์ด ๋ถ๋ถ์ ์ด์ฉ ์ ์๋ ๋ถ๋ถ์ธ ๋ฏ...
๋๋ ๋ฐ์ดํฐ๋ฒ ์ด์ค๋ ํ๋ฉด ๋ ๋ค ์ด๋ฏธ ์ด๋์ ๋ ํ ์ค ์๊ธฐ ๋๋ฌธ์ ํฐ ๋ฌด๋ฆฌ๊ฐ ์์์ง๋ง
์์ ์ ์น ๊ฐ๋ฐ ์ด๋ณด์๊ฐ ๋ณธ๋ค๊ณ ํ๋ค๋ฉด ์ด๋ฐ ๋ถ๋ถ์ ์ข ํ๋ค ์ ์์ ๊ฒ ๊ฐ๋ค.
์ด ๋ถ๋ถ์ ๋จธ๋ฆฌ๋ง์ ํจ๊ป ๋ณด๋ฉด ์ข์ ๋ค๋ฅธ ๊ต์ฌ๋ค๋ ์๋ด๋์ด ์์ผ๋
๋ค๋ฅธ ์ธ์ด๋ค๋๋ฌธ์ ์ฑ ์ ๋ฐ๋ผ๊ฐ๊ธฐ ๋๋ฌด ํ๋ค๋ค๋ผ๊ณ ํ๋ค๋ฉด ์ฐธ๊ณ ํ๋ฉด ๋์์ด ๋ ๋ฏ ํ๋ค!
์ข์ ์ 3. ์ฑ ํ๋๋ก ์์ฑ๋๋ ๊ทธ๋ด์ธํ(?) ์ค์ต ๊ฒฐ๊ณผ๋ฌผ
์ฑ ์ ๋ฐ๋ผ ์ฐจ๊ทผ์ฐจ๊ทผ ๋๊น์ง ์ค์ตํ๊ฒ ๋๋ฉด
์ต์ข ์ ์ผ๋ก ๊ธฐ๋ณธ๊ตฌ์ฑ์ ์น ์ฌ์ดํธ ํ๋๋ฅผ ์ ์ํ๊ฒ ๋๋ค๊ณ ํ๋ค.
( ๋๋ ์์ง ์ถ์ฒ ๊ธฐ๋ฅ๊น์ง๋ฐ์ ๋ชป ๋ง๋ค์๋ค... )
์๋ ๋งํฌ ์ฌ์ดํธ๋ ์ ์๊ฐ ๊ณต์ ํ
Do it! ์ ํ ํฌ ์คํ๋ง ๋ถํธ3 ๊ต์ฌ์ ์ต์ข ์ฐ์ถ๋ฌผ์ด๋ค!
https://sbb.pybo.kr/question/list
์ด๋ ๊ฒ๊น์ง ์ด ์ฑ ํ๋๋ง ๊ฐ์ง๊ณ ํด๋ณผ ์ ์์๊น ์ถ์ง๋ง
๋ฐ๋ผ ์์ ํ๋ค ์ดํด๊ฐ ์๋๊ฑฐ๋ ๋งํ๋ ๋ถ๋ถ์ ์ ์ ์ ํ๋ธ ์ฑ๋์ ํตํด ์ง์ ์ง๋ฌธ ํ ์๋ ์์๊ณ
git ์์ ์ต์ข ์์ฑ ์์ค๋ฅผ ๋ค์ด๋ฐ์ ์ ์์ด ์์ฑ๋ณธ๊ณผ ๋น๊ตํ๋ฉฐ ์์ ํ ์ ์๊ฒ ํด๋์๋ค.
์๋ง ์ ๋งํด์ ์ด๋ ค์ ์์ด ๋ฐ๋ผ๊ฐ ์ ์์๊ฑฐ๋ผ๊ณ ๋ณธ๋ค!
๊ทธ๋ฆฌ๊ณ ๋ง์ง๋ง ์ฑํฐ์์๋ ๊ฐ์ฅ ์ค์ํ! ๋ฐฐํฌํ๋ ๋ฐฉ๋ฒ๋ ์๋ ค์ค๋ค.
๋๋ ํ์ ์์ ๋ด์ฉ์ค์์๋ ๋ฐฐํฌ๊ฐ ๊ฐ์ฅ ์ด๋ ค์ ๋ค.
๋ฌผ๋ก ์ง๊ธ๋ ์ด๋ ค์ ...
AWS ์๋ง์กด ์น ์๋ฒ ๊ธฐ์ค์ผ๋ก ์์ฑ๋์ด ์๋๋ฐ
๊ธฐ์กด์ ์ค๋ผํด ํด๋ผ์ฐ๋๋ก๋ง ํด๋ด์ ๋์ค์ ์ด๊ฒ๋ ์ฒ์ฒํ ๋ฐ๋ผ ํด๋ณผ ์์ ์ด๋ค.
์์ฌ์ด ์ ํ๋... ๋ณธ๋ฌธ ํ์ดํ ๊ฐ๋ ์ฑ
์ฑ ๋ณด๋ค๊ฐ ๋ถํธํ ๋ถ๋ถ์ด ํ๋ ์์๋๋ฐ
๋ณธ๋ฌธ์ ํ์ดํ์ด ํฐํธ๋๋ฌธ์ ๊ฐ๋ ์ฑ์ด ๋จ์ด์ง๋ ์ ์ด์๋ค.
์์ด๊ฐ ์งง๋ค๋ณด๋ ... ์ด๋ฐ ํฐํธ๋ก ์ ๋ ๊ฒ ๊ธด ์์ด ๋ฌธ๊ตฌ๊ฐ ์ ํ์ ธ ์์ผ๋๊น
๋์ ํ ๋ค์ด์ค์ง ์๋ ๊ฒ์ด ์์ฌ์ ๋ค.
๋ด๊ฐ ์์ด๋ ์์นํด์ ๊ทธ๋ฐ ๊ฑธ ์๋ ์๋ค ... ๐
์ต์ข ํ๊ฐ
" ์คํ๋ง๋ถํธ๋ก ๊ทธ๋ด์ธํ ์ฌ์ดํธ ํ ๋ฒ ๋ง๋ค์ด๋ณด๊ณ ์ถ๋ค๋ฉด? ๊ฐ๋ ฅ ์ถ์ฒ ๐โ๏ธ "
์ด ์ : 9.5 โ
์คํ๋ง๋ถํธ ๊ต์ฌ๋ฅผ ์ฐพ๋ค ์ํ๋จ ๋ชจ์งํ๊ธธ๋ ๋น์ฒจ๋์ด์ ๋ฐ์ ์ฑ ์ธ๋ฐ
์ ๋ง์ ๋ง x 100 ๊ธฐ๋ ์ด์์ด์๋ค!
์ฌ์ค ์์ฌ์ด ์ ๋ ๊ฐ ์ ๋๋ ์ฐ๋ ค๊ณ ํ๋๋ฐ ์๋ฌด๋ฆฌ ๋ด๋ ์์ด์ ๋ชป์ผ๋ค ๐
์ฐ์ ๋์ฒ๋ผ ์คํ๋ง ๋ถํธ ์ข ์จ๋ดค๊ณ ์ ์ฒด์ ์ธ ๋งฅ๋ฝ๋ ์ด๋์ ๋ ํ์ ํ๊ณ ์๋ ์ ์์๋
๊ฐ๋ ๋ค์ง๊ธฐ + ์์ฉ ๋ฐ ํ์ฉ ํ๊ธฐ ๋ฑ ์ข์ ๊ต์ฌ์ด๊ณ
์ด๋ณด์๋ ์ ์๊ฐ ๋จธ๋ฆฟ๋ง์ ์ ์ด๋์ ์ฐธ๊ณ ํ๋ฉด ์ข์ ๋ค๋ฅธ ๊ต์ฌ๋ค๊ณผ ํจ๊ป ๋ณด๋ ๊ฒ์ ์ถ์ฒํ๋ค.
์ด ์ฑ ์ ์ด์ง์คํผ๋ธ๋ฆฌ์ฑ์ ์ํ๋จ์ผ๋ก ์ ์ ๋์ด ์ ๊ณต๋ฐ์์ต๋๋ค.